National park projects in Nunavik

On April 9, 2002, the Makivik Corporation, the Kativik Regional Government (KRG) and the Government of Québec signed a partnership agreement on community and economic development in Nunavik. This agreement provided for the creation of the parc national des Pingualuit and three other parks whose purpose is to protect samples of the natural heritage of this region of Québec’s and support the growth of tourism in Nunavik:

Although not yet scheduled for studies involving knowledge acquisition, another Nunavik national park project has been planned and its territory designated as reserved for the parc national des Monts-de-Puvirnituq project.

Territories reserved for park creation

A number of other sites have been reserved by the government for the purpose of creating parks. These areas have been withdrawn from mineral staking, by decrees 91-192 and 92-170. The Ministère will begin work on these sites in the coming years.
